| Named executive officer | Salary | Bonus | Stock awards | Option awards | Non-equity incentive | Pension / NQDC | All other |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Lisa Barton | $1,136,937 | $0 | $5,471,255 | $0 | $1,835,563 | $111 | $555,207 | $8,999,073 |
| President and Chief Executive Officer | ||||||||
| Antonio Smyth | 471,366 | 220,000 | 2,999,569 | 0 | 660,400 | 0 | 360,144 | 4,711,479 |
| Executive Vice President | ||||||||
| Robert Durian | 702,693 | 0 | 1,680,516 | 0 | 770,951 | 13,726 | 254,020 | 3,421,906 |
|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er | ||||||||
| Raja Sundararajan | 652,500 | 0 | 1,492,574 | 0 | 673,600 | 0 | 410,633 | 3,229,307 |
| Executive Vice President and Chief Strategy Officer | ||||||||
| David de Leon | 481,847 | 0 | 651,289 | 0 | 467,326 | 12,000 | 108,601 | 1,721,063 |
| Senior Vice President | ||||||||
A dash means the company reported no figure in that column; 0 means it reported zero. Figures are as printed in the filing, without adjustment.

| Meeting year | Meeting date | For | Against | Abstain | Support | Outcome |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 | 2026-05-20 | 196,043,476 | 8,748,646 | 1,042,626 | 95.73% | Passed |
| 2025 | 2025-05-16 | 193,099,366 | 7,164,262 | 1,078,767 | 96.42% | Passed |
| 2024 | 2024-05-17 | 189,645,167 | 8,498,044 | 974,745 | 95.71% | Passed |
| 2023 | 2023-05-23 | 181,184,866 | 7,956,109 | 1,016,162 | 95.79% | Passed |
| 2022 | 2022-05-19 | 181,141,240 | 9,179,311 | 1,153,214 | 95.18% | Passed |
| 2021 | 2021-05-20 | 179,845,975 | 7,214,916 | 1,490,219 | 96.14% | Passed |
Rows are labeled by annual-meeting year, with the meeting date beside each; the vote held in a given year acts on the prior fiscal year's compensation.

Most recent fiscal-year chief executive compensation at each disclosed peer, taken from that company's own proxy statement.
| Rank | Company | FY | Chief executive | Salary | Stock awards | Option awards | Non-equity incentive |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Eversource Energy | 2025 | Joseph R. Nolan, Jr. | $1,432,308 | $9,020,890 | $0 | $3,000,000 | $14,987,168 |
| 2 | Ameren Corporation | 2025 | Martin Lyons | 1,325,000 | 8,320,680 | 0 | 3,323,575 | 14,056,510 |
| 3 | Public Service Enterprise Group | 2025 | Ralph LaRossa | 1,386,000 | 9,000,153 | 0 | 2,563,400 | 13,866,735 |
| 4 | PPL Corp | 2025 | Vincent Sorgi | 1,238,060 | 7,865,249 | 0 | 1,869,248 | 13,221,331 |
| 5 | NiSource Inc. | 2025 | Lloyd Yates | 1,191,667 | 9,619,864 | 0 | 2,261,784 | 13,197,800 |
| 6 | WEC Energy Group, Inc. | 2025 | Scott Lauber | 1,205,700 | 5,405,848 | 990,235 | 3,535,789 | 12,188,492 |
| 7 | CenterPoint Energy, Inc. | 2025 | Jason Wells | 1,226,923 | 7,625,023 | 0 | 2,583,750 | 12,092,341 |
| 8 | OGE Energy Corporation | 2025 | Sean Trauschke | 1,239,372 | 5,811,824 | 0 | 1,753,487 | 12,032,007 |
| 9 | CMS Energy Corporation | 2025 | Garrick Rochow | 1,275,000 | 6,763,239 | 0 | 2,055,938 | 10,534,039 |
| 10 | Southwest Gas Holdings Inc | 2025 | Karen Haller | 1,090,685 | 5,776,085 | 0 | 1,861,200 | 10,029,409 |
| 11 | Atmos Energy Corporation | 2025 | J. Kevin Akers | 1,147,802 | 5,179,057 | 0 | 2,100,572 | 9,953,274 |
| 12 | Evergy, Inc. | 2025 | David Campbell | 1,123,142 | 7,004,446 | 0 | 1,342,969 | 9,537,018 |
| 13 | Alliant Energy Corp | 2025 | Lisa Barton | 1,136,937 | 5,471,255 | 0 | 1,835,563 | 8,999,073 |
| 14 | Portland General Electric Co. | 2025 | Maria Pope | 1,205,111 | 4,549,047 | 0 | 1,235,019 | 7,583,877 |
| 15 | IDACORP, Inc. | 2025 | Lisa Grow | 1,050,000 | 2,942,308 | 0 | 1,785,001 | 7,529,892 |
| 16 | Black Hills Corporation | 2025 | Linden Evans | 995,594 | 2,966,688 | 0 | 1,294,886 | 5,991,759 |
| 17 | MDU Resources Group, Inc. | 2025 | Nicole Kivisto | 925,000 | 2,600,313 | 0 | 1,169,200 | 4,812,252 |
| 18 | Avista Corporation | 2025 | Heather Rosentrater | 786,845 | 2,653,743 | 0 | 897,732 | 4,773,308 |
| 19 | Hawaiian Electric Industries, Inc. | 2025 | Scott W. Seu | 1,024,900 | 1,721,450 | 0 | 0 | 4,430,919 |
| 20 | TXNM Energy, Inc. | 2025 | Joseph Tarry | 839,462 | 2,275,011 | 0 | 495,058 | 3,903,948 |
| 21 | Pinnacle West Capital Corporation | 2025 | Robert Smith | 514,658 | 1,360,231 | — | 421,609 | 2,708,803 |
Each peer's compensation is from its most recently filed proxy; fiscal years differ by company. Each peer's figures come from its own filings; the subject company is highlighted. Peers whose chief executive compensation is outside our coverage universe are stated as such, never left blank.
| Company | Annual incentive payout | Long-term vehicle mix | PSU measures include TSR | Compensation consultant |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Alliant Energy Corp | 130% | PSU 75 · RSU 25 | No | Pay Governance LLC |
| Ameren Corporation | 193.3% |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| No | Meridian Compensation Partners |
| Atmos Energy Corporation | 153% | PSU 75 · RSU 25 | No | Meridian Compensation Partners, LLC |
| Avista Corporation | 114% | PSU 65 · RSU 35 | No | Meridian Compensation Partners |
| Black Hills Corporation | 118.4% | PSU 60 · RSU 40 | Yes — Relative Total Shareholder Return (rTSR) | Meridian |
| CenterPoint Energy, Inc. | 159% |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| Yes — Relative TSR | Meridian Compensation Partners, LLC |
| CMS Energy Corporation | 129% | PSU 75 · RSU 25 | Yes — Relative TSR Performance | Pay Governance LLC |
| Evergy, Inc. | 95.5% |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| Yes — Three Year Relative TSR versus Companies in the EEI Index | Meridian |
| Eversource Energy | 145% | PSU 75 · RSU 25 | No | Pay Governance |
| Hawaiian Electric Industries, Inc. | not disclosed | PSU 50 · Cash LTI 50 | No | Frederic W. Cook & Co., Inc. |
| IDACORP, Inc. | 170% | PSU 67 · RSU 33 | Yes — TSR | Pay Governance |
| MDU Resources Group, Inc. | 126.4% |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| Yes — Three-Year rTSR | Independent compensation consultant (nationally-recognized firm; name not disclosed in CD&A) |
| NiSource Inc. | 146% | PSU 80 · RSU 20 | Yes — Three-Year RTSR | Meridian Compensation Partners |
| OGE Energy Corporation | 118% | PSU 65 · RSU 35 | No | Mercer |
| Pinnacle West Capital Corporation | 197.5% |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| Yes — Relative TSR | FW Cook |
| Portland General Electric Co. | not disclosed |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| Yes — Relative Total Shareholder Return (TSR) | FW Cook |
| PPL Corp | 116.14% | PSU 80 · RSU 20 | Yes — Total Shareowner Return (TSR) | FW Cook |
| Public Service Enterprise Group | not disclosed |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| Yes — Relative TSR versus peer panel | Compensation Advisory Partners (CAP) |
| Southwest Gas Holdings Inc | 141% | PSU 60 · RSU 40 | No | Aon Human Capital Solutions |
| TXNM Energy, Inc. | 50% |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| Yes — Relative TSR Goal | Pay Governance |
| WEC Energy Group, Inc. | not disclosed | PSU 65 · RSU 20 · Option 15 | not disclosed | Frederic W. Cook & Co., Inc. |
Read from each company's Compensation Discussion and Analysis: annual incentive payout as a percentage of target, the disclosed long-term vehicle mix, whether performance-share measures include a total shareholder return component, and the retained compensation consultant. “Not disclosed” appears only where the company's filing does not state the item.
